1
0
forked from pool/python-sparse
Files
python-sparse/python-sparse.changes

156 lines
6.6 KiB
Plaintext
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

-------------------------------------------------------------------
Fri Feb 12 14:15:38 UTC 2021 - Dirk Müller <dmueller@suse.com>
- skip python 3.6 build
-------------------------------------------------------------------
Mon Dec 28 11:56:48 UTC 2020 - Benjamin Greiner <code@bnavigator.de>
- Update to 0.11.2
* Fix TypingError on sparse.dot with complex dtypes. (Issue #403,
PR #404)
- Changelog for 0.11.1
* Fix ValueError on sparse.dot with extremely small values.
(Issue #398, PR #399)
- Changelog for 0.11.0
* Improve the performance of sparse.dot. (Issue #331, PR #389,
thanks @daletovar)
* Added the COO.swapaxes method. (PR #344, thanks @lueckem)
* Added multi-axis 1-D indexing support. (PR #343, thanks
@mikeymezher)
* Fix outer for arrays that werent one-dimensional. (Issue #346,
PR #347)
* Add casting kwarg to COO.astype. (Issue #391, PR #392)
* Fix for COO constructor accepting invalid inputs. (Issue #385,
PR #386)
- Changelog for 0.10.0
* Fixed a bug where converting an empty DOK array to COO leads to
an incorrect dtype. (Issue #314, PR #315)
* Change code formatter to black. (PR #284)
* Add COO.flatten and sparse.outer. (Issue #316, PR #317).
* Remove broadcasting restriction between sparse arrays and dense
arrays. (Issue #306, PR #318)
* Implement deterministic dask tokenization. (Issue #300, PR
#320, thanks @danielballan)
* Improve testing around densification (PR #321, thanks
@danielballan)
* Simplify Numba extension. (PR #324, thanks @eric-wieser).
* Respect copy=False in astype (PR #328, thanks @eric-wieser).
* Replace linear_loc with ravel_multi_index, which is 3x faster.
(PR #330, thanks @eric-wieser).
* Add error msg to tensordot operation when ndim==0 (Issue #332,
PR #333, thanks @guilhermeleobas).
* Maintainence fixes for Sphinx 3.0 and Numba 0.49, and dropping
support for Python 3.5. (PR #337).
* Fixed signature for numpy.clip.
- Changelog for 0.9.1
* Fixed a bug where indexing with an empty list could lead to
issues. (Issue #281, PR #282)
* Change code formatter to black. (PR #284)
* Add the diagonal and diagonalize functions. (Issue #288, PR
#289, thanks @pettni)
* Add HTML repr for notebooks. (PR #283, thanks @daletovar)
* Avoid making copy of coords when making a new COO array.
* Add stack and concatenate for GCXS. (Issue #301, PR #303,
thanks @daletovar).
* Fix issue where functions dispatching to an attribute access
wouldnt work with __array_function__. (Issue #308, PR #309).
* Add partial support for constructing and mirroring COO objects
to Numba.
- add sparse-pr421-fix-cootype.patch
* gh#pydata/sparse#420
* gh#pydata/sparse#421
-------------------------------------------------------------------
Thu Sep 5 13:38:18 UTC 2019 - Todd R <toddrme2178@gmail.com>
- Update to 0.8.0
* Fixed a bug where an array with size == 1 and nnz == 0
could not be broadcast.
* Add ``std`` and ``var``.
* Move to Azure Pipelines with CI for Windows, macOS and
Linux.
* Add ``resize``, and change ``reshape`` so it raises a
``ValueError`` on shapes that don't correspond to the
same size.
* Add ``isposinf`` and ``isneginf``.
* Fix ``tensordot`` when nnz = 0.
* Modifications to ``__array_function__`` to allow for sparse
XArrays.
* Add not-yet-public support for GCXS.
* Improvements to ``__array_function__``.
* Convert all Numba lists to typed lists.
* Why write code when it exists elsewhere?
* Fix some element-wise operations with scalars.
* Private modules should be private, and tests should be in the package.
-------------------------------------------------------------------
Tue Apr 9 08:57:08 UTC 2019 - pgajdos@suse.com
- version update to 0.7.0
* python3-only package, for other changes see changelog.rst
-------------------------------------------------------------------
Tue Dec 4 12:54:33 UTC 2018 - Matej Cepl <mcepl@suse.com>
- Remove superfluous devel dependency for noarch package
-------------------------------------------------------------------
Sun Jul 29 12:33:18 UTC 2018 - jengelh@inai.de
- Update descriptions.
-------------------------------------------------------------------
Thu May 24 17:46:54 UTC 2018 - toddrme2178@gmail.com
- Update to 0.3.1
* Add Elementwise broadcasting and broadcast_to (:pr:`35`) `Hameer Abbasi`_
* Add Bitwise ops (:pr:`38`) `Hameer Abbasi`_
* Add slicing support for Ellipsis and None (:pr:`37`) `Matthew Rocklin`_
* Add triu and tril and tests (:pr:`40`) `Hameer Abbasi`_
* Extend gitignore file (:pr:`42`) `Nils Werner`_
* Update MANIFEST.in (:pr:`45`) `Matthew Rocklin`_
* Remove auto densification and unify operator code (:pr:`46`) `Hameer Abbasi`_
* Fix nnz for scalars (:pr:`48`) `Hameer Abbasi`_
* Update README (:pr:`50`) (:pr:`53`) `Hameer Abbasi`_
* Fix large concatenations and stacks (:pr:`50`) `Hameer Abbasi`_
* Add __array_ufunc__ for __call__ and reduce (:pr:`49`) `Hameer Abbasi`_
* Update documentation (:pr:`54`) `Hameer Abbasi`_
* Flake8 and coverage in pytest (:pr:`59`) `Nils Werner`_
* Copy constructor (:pr:`55`) `Nils Werner`_
* Add random function (:pr:`41`) `Nils Werner`_
* Add lots of indexing features (:pr:`57`) `Hameer Abbasi`_
* Validate .transpose axes (:pr:`61`) `Nils Werner`_
* Simplify axes normalization logic `Nils Werner`_
* User higher density for sparse.random in tests (:pr:`64`) `Keisuke Fujii`_
* Support left-side np.number elemwise operations (:pr:`67`) `Keisuke Fujii`_
* Support len on COO (:pr:`68`) `Nils Werner`_
* Update scipy version in requirements (:pr:`70`) `Hameer Abbasi`_
* Documentation (:pr:`43`) `Nils Werner`_ and `Hameer Abbasi`_
* Use Tox for cross Python-version testing (:pr:`77`) `Nils Werner`_
* Support mixed sparse-dense when result is sparse (:pr:`75`) `Hameer Abbasi`_
* Update contributing.rst (:pr:`76`) `Hameer Abbasi`_
* Size and density properties (:pr:`69`) `Nils Werner`_
* Fix large sum (:pr:`83`) `Hameer Abbasi`_
* Add DOK (:pr:`85`) `Hameer Abbasi`_
* Implement __array__ protocol (:pr:`87`) `Matthew Rocklin`_
- spec file cleanups
-------------------------------------------------------------------
Thu Nov 2 03:18:40 UTC 2017 - arun@gmx.de
- update to version 0.1.1:
* Add @ operator (simplify) (#16)
* Opt in to caching
* Cache reshape and transpose
* Add tocsr method and sorted checking
* Fix windows errors around int/long
* use elemwise_binary in __add__
* Fix bug in large reductions
* Add out= keywords to ufuncs
-------------------------------------------------------------------
Thu May 25 16:49:28 UTC 2017 - toddrme2178@gmail.com
- Initial version